Pink Floyd’s second album titled”A saucerful of secrets “ Columbia SX 6258 mono. Blue/Black label 1st pressing mono.released 1968.Matrix information side 1 xax 3633-1 1G side 2 xax 3634-1 1G Earlier possible release of the first 500/1000 albums released.Mistake on label side one that says” let there me more light “when should be “let there be more light” with original Columbia advertising inner sleeve.The front laminated flipback sleeve is made by garrod and lofthouse.This album is from a collection of records that I bought from a record reviewer from early 1960 to 1970’s.LPs were only played once or twice for reviewing purposes only and then stored away.This comes with the original mailing envelope that the record was sent out in to the record reviewer.Mailer still has the post stamp date 68.
